Call for Proposals: Breakout Session and Poster Presentation Abstracts


The e-Science Symposium Planning Committee invites you to submit a proposal for participation at the 9th Annual University of Massachusetts and New England Area Librarian eScience Symposium, to be held on Thursday, April 6th, 2017 at the University of Massachusetts Medical School in Worcester, MA.



This year's symposium theme "Libraries in Data Science: Addressing Gaps and Bridges" focuses on collaborations and opportunities for librarians becoming involved in data science at their institutions. In our Keynote, we will hear from Kristi Holmes<http://www.feinberg.northwestern.edu/faculty-profiles/az/profile.html?xid=29964>, Director, Galter Health Sciences Library, about her library's success involved in Northwestern University's NIH Clinical and Translational Science Award. Our afternoon panel will be moderated by Sally Gore<https://works.bepress.com/sally_gore/>, Research Evaluation Analyst for the University of Massachusetts Center for Clinical and Translational Science, and former informationist at the Lamar Soutter Library.

We are interested in receiving proposals for presentations, interactive workshops and posters that highlight librarians involved in collaborations with a research group, department, center, or lab on or off their respective academic campus.

To submit a proposal, please refer to the submission instructions<http://escholarship.umassmed.edu/escience_symposium/proposals.html>.

Proposals should be tied to one of these four categories:

  1.  Data Repositories (example: developing data repositories; advising researchers on discipline-specific repositories)
  2.  Education/Training (example: data information literacy)
  3.  Funding Agencies (example: writing data management plan templates for NIH)
  4.  Institutional Models (example: solo data librarian vs center/team)

Breakout Sessions: 60 minute presentation or interactive workshop. Selected presenters will receive an honorarium and all travel expenses paid for by the NN/LM NER. All sessions will be video recorded and featured on the e-Science Symposium website. Because there are a limited number of breakout sessions, all presentation and interactive workshop proposals will be considered for a poster presentation.
The deadline for submitting a Breakout Session abstract is Wednesday, December 21st, 2016.
Proposal decisions will be made by Friday, January 20th, 2017

Poster Session: Awards to the Most Informative Poster in Communicating e-Science Librarianship, Poster for Best Example of e-Science in Action, and Best Poster Overall.
The deadline for submitting a Poster Session abstract is Wednesday, February 8th, 2017.
Proposal decisions will be made by Friday, February 24th, 2017

Electronic presentation materials (PowerPoints, PDFs, etc) will be required to be submitted by Wednesday, March 22nd, 2017 to be posted on the e-Science Symposium website and stored permanently with a Creative Commons License in the eScholarship at UMMS Open Access Repository following the symposium.
